The Town of Lenox is located in the center of New York State in Madison County.

The Township includes the Village of Wampsville, which is home for the County offices and the Village of Canastota. Canastota is exit 34 on the New York State Thruway and home of the Boxing Hall of Fame. Lenox is a combination of villages and rural life. The Erie Canal, the shores of Oneida Lake and picturesque countryside are all part of the Town of Lenox.
